Introduction
The LM2574HVM-3.3 is part of the SIMPLE SWITCHER® series from Texas Instruments, designed for easy-to-use step-down (buck) voltage regulation in various electronic applications.
Product Features and Performance
Simple and easy-to-use step-down voltage regulator
Capable of driving a 500mA load with excellent line and load regulation
Requires a minimum number of external components for operation
Fixed 3.3V output voltage
Operates at a switching frequency of 52kHz
Thermal shutdown and current limit for safety
Product Advantages
Versatility with a wide input voltage range from 4V to 60V
Robust thermal performance with a junction operating temperature range from -40°C to 125°C
High-efficiency design suitable for battery-powered systems
Small footprint with surface mount 14-SOIC package
Key Technical Parameters
Step-Down (Buck) topology
Positive output configuration
One output channel
4V minimum input voltage
60V maximum input voltage
3V fixed output voltage
500mA current output
52kHz switching frequency
Non-synchronous rectifier
Operating temperature from -40°C to 125°C (TJ)
14-SOIC package
